Because breaking ground [i.e. moving graves] is among the unsuitable days for today, October 8, 2020, the Cold Dew day, is not suitable for moving graves!Songs about the Cold Dew solar termDuring the Cold Dew season, the weather gets colder and farmers are busy every day.Wheat planting is still in full swing, but late rice harvesting is in a hurry. Sweet potatoes left for seeds are afraid of frost damage, and soybeans are harvested in the open air in the cold weather. It’s time to harvest the yellow flowers, and pick cotton in sunny weather. In the late-maturing cotton fields, do not delay in using chemicals to ripen the cotton. When grafting cucumbers in greenhouses, heat preservation and moisture retention are the key. Pick the purple hawthorns, and the bright red pomegranates are sour and sweet. After unloading the fruits, we take care of the trees, apply fertilizers, spray pesticides and turn the soil. It is a good time to collect tree species, and local seed sources are the key. There are techniques for feeding livestock and poultry, and pregnant livestock must be taken care of carefully. Overwintering fish must be fattened and adult fish must be caught using lotus roots and starch. The benefits of eating persimmons during the Cold Dew seasonThere is a folk proverb that goes, "Walnuts mature in the Beginning of Autumn, pears mature in the White Dew, and persimmons turn red in the Cold Dew." The soft and glutinous persimmons mature in autumn. The fruit is sweet and astringent, and is cold in nature. It enters the lungs, spleen, and stomach, clearing away heat and moistening the lungs.The vitamins and sugars it contains are one to two times higher than those of ordinary fruits. It can nourish the lungs and protect the stomach, clear away dryness and heat. Regular consumption can replenish the body, relieve cough, promote bowel movements, and eliminate heat.
